CHICAGO (AP) - The Boston Bruins came within inches of blowing a 4-0 lead. But Tim Thomas saved them with his catching glove. Glen Murray, Mark Mowers, Milan Jurcina, Patrice Bergeron and Marc Savard scored, and Boston held on for a 5-3 victory over the Chicago Blackhawks on Friday night.
The Bruins, who led 4-0 after two periods, improved to 4-0-1 in their last five games and 5-1-1 in their last seven. But Chicago rallied on goals by Jim Wisniewski, Bryan Smolinski and Denis Arkhipov in a 4:19 span early in the third to cut it to 4-3.
Thomas, who stopped 37 shots, made his most spectacular save with 1:44 left in the third. With the score still 4-3, he sprawled across the crease to snare Jeff Hamilton's point-blank attempt.
